Exempel på hur man kan använda PERMUTATION i en mening

  • He was one of the first to rigorously state and prove the key theorems of calculus (thereby creating real analysis), pioneered the field complex analysis, and the study of permutation groups in abstract algebra.
  • In mathematics, a permutation group is a group G whose elements are permutations of a given set M and whose group operation is the composition of permutations in G (which are thought of as bijective functions from the set M to itself).
  • In a set, all that matters is whether each element is in it or not, so the ordering of the elements in roster notation is irrelevant (in contrast, in a sequence, a tuple, or a permutation of a set, the ordering of the terms matters).
  • In cryptography, a transposition cipher (also known as a permutation cipher) is a method of encryption which scrambles the positions of characters (transposition) without changing the characters themselves.
  • Although such a decomposition is not unique, the parity of the number of transpositions in all decompositions is the same, implying that the sign of a permutation is well-defined.
  • This allowed him to characterize the polynomial equations that are solvable by radicals in terms of properties of the permutation group of their roots—an equation is by definition solvable by radicals if its roots may be expressed by a formula involving only integers, th roots, and the four basic arithmetic operations.
  • In a worst-case scenario with this version, the random source is of low quality and happens to make the sorted permutation unboundedly unlikely to occur.
  • Equivalently, g(n) is the largest least common multiple (lcm) of any partition of n, or the maximum number of times a permutation of n elements can be recursively applied to itself before it returns to its starting sequence.
  • In combinatorial mathematics, a derangement is a permutation of the elements of a set in which no element appears in its original position.
  • even and odd permutations, a permutation of a finite set is even if it is composed of an even number of transpositions.
  • A sequence of random variables is called exchangeable if the joint distribution of the sequence is unchanged by any permutation of the indices.
  • In mathematics, particularly in linear algebra, tensor analysis, and differential geometry, the Levi-Civita symbol or Levi-Civita epsilon represents a collection of numbers defined from the sign of a permutation of the natural numbers , for some positive integer.
  • This property may be written symbolically as perm(A) = perm(PAQ) for any appropriately sized permutation matrices P and Q,.
  • There are two natural one-to-one correspondences between permutations and permutation matrices, one of which works along the rows of the matrix, the other along its columns.
  • Even and odd permutations, a permutation of a finite set is odd if it is composed of an odd number of transpositions.
  • In mathematics, a generalized permutation matrix (or monomial matrix) is a matrix with the same nonzero pattern as a permutation matrix, i.
  • If one takes the perspective that the definition of entropy must be changed so as to ignore particle permutation, in the thermodynamic limit, the paradox is averted.
  • Commutation matrix, a permutation matrix which is used for transforming the vectorized form of another matrix into the vectorized form of its transpose.
  • For example, for the general linear group GL, a maximal torus is the subgroup D of invertible diagonal matrices, whose normalizer is the generalized permutation matrices (matrices in the form of permutation matrices, but with any non-zero numbers in place of the '1's), and whose Weyl group is the symmetric group.
  • An odd permutation of the corners implies an odd permutation of the centres and vice versa; however, even and odd permutations of the centres are indistinguishable due to the identical appearance of the pieces.
